Pencil not showing guide line in Illustrator

  • April 3, 2025
  • 4 replies
  • 1564 views

I reset my Illustrator preferences recently and now I cannot see the guide line that appears when using the pencil tool to show what shape you are drawing. Is there an option I missed that can turn this on?

lauracollab,

 

I had the same thing happen to me recently. Deselect the check box for the new "Live preview" feature that Adobe just added. That should do the trick. See the link below for this new feature (that I don't need). (I've been using Illustrator for 28 years!)
